If AT&T ringtones have their way you could soon be hearing Donald Trumps signature quote whenever your mobile phone rings. AT&T that acquired Cingular Wireless to form the largest mobile phone company in the United States is rumored to be thinking of testing advertisement on AT&T ringtones. They will need to be quick innovative to avoid irritating the subscribers.
On the more practical end you will now be able to get the worst of "American Idol" auditions as a ring tone. AT&T has renewed its deal with Fox, Freemantle Media and 19 Entertainment to provide American idol fans with mobile access to memorable moments from the shows auditions. This will not be restricted to ring tones; video clips will also e available.
Using the recently acquired cell phone company, AT&T ringtones are positioning themselves to make a splash in the ring tone market. And just to show you how seriously they are taking this, AT&T have a demo webpage where you can type in text and it is translated to an audio ring tone. These are known as voice tones or voice ring tones. The page can covert English, German or even Spanish text to a voice tone.
To access AT&T ring tones, you need to subscribe to the MEdia Max Bundle. You get a webpage from where you can download your ring tones.
